Sash Window Renovation Near Me: An In-Depth Guide
Sash windows are an essential feature of many historical and modern properties. Their elegant style and performance enhance the aesthetic appeal of a home while offering light, ventilation, and a link to the architectural past. However, like any function of a home, Sash Window Installers Nearby windows require maintenance, and in some cases, renovation. If you're thinking about refreshing your sash windows, this detailed guide will stroll you through what to anticipate and how to find Sash Window Restoration Specialists window renovation services close by.
Understanding Sash WindowsWhat are Sash Windows?
Sash Window Refurbishing Services windows consist of one or more movable panels, or "sashes," that hold glass and are traditionally designed to slide vertically or horizontally. They're often made from timber and can come in various styles, including:
Single-hung: Only the top sash is repaired, while the bottom sash can move.Double-hung: Both sashes can slide, allowing for more airflow control.Sliding sash: Both sashes move horizontally.Benefits of Renovating Sash Windows
Refurbishing sash windows can yield numerous benefits:
Improved Energy Efficiency: Older windows might not be well-sealed, leading to considerable energy loss. Renovation can add insulation and weather condition removing.Enhanced Aesthetics: Restoring wooden frames and replacing old glazing can refresh the appearance of your residential or commercial property.Conservation of Historical Value: Renovating original functions preserves the character of period homes, frequently valued in locations with stringent architectural standards.Increased Property Value: Well-maintained sash windows can boost a home's market worth.Key Aspects of Sash Window RenovationTypical Renovation Tasks
When seeking sash window renovation services, it's important to know what particular tasks might be included in the service. Here prevail renovation treatments:
Sash Replacement: Damaged or deteriorated sashes are replaced with new, historically suitable products.Painting & & Finishing: New coats of paint and finishing can safeguard the wood and enhance look.Weather Stripping: Adding or changing weather stripping to improve insulation and reduce drafts.Glazing Repair: Replacing broken glass and re-sealing existing glazing to avoid leaks.Balancing Weights: Ensuring that the counterweights in double-hung windows are operating correctly for smooth operation.The Renovation Process
The sash window renovation process typically includes numerous phases:
Assessment: A professional will evaluate the condition of the windows.Quote: A quote covering the scope of work and expenses is offered.Preparation: Protecting surrounding areas and gathering needed products.Renovation Work: Performing the renovation jobs, which may last from a couple of hours to several days, depending upon the extent of the work.Finishing Touches: Final inspections and painting or sealing to complete the job.TaskTime EstimateCost EstimateSash Replacement1-2 days₤ 200 - ₤ 600 per sashPainting & & Finishing1-3 days₤ 150 - ₤ 400Weather condition Stripping1 day₤ 50 - ₤ 150Glazing Repair1-2 days₤ 100 - ₤ 300Balancing WeightsA few hours₤ 50 - ₤ 120Discovering Sash Window Renovation Services Near You

Get QuotesMultiple Estimates: Reach out to different contractors for quotes to compare rates and services used.Ask Detailed Questions: Ensure the estimates outline what is included in the service to prevent any concealed expenses.FAQs about Sash Window RenovationQ1: How frequently should sash windows be remodelled?
A1: Renovation needs can vary; however, it's advisable to examine sash windows every 5-10 years, especially if they're exposed to harsh weather condition conditions.
Q2: Can I DIY sash window renovation?
A2: Some minor repairs can be DIY, such as painting; nevertheless, significant remodellings, particularly including structural elements, are best left to specialists.
Q3: How much does sash window renovation typically cost?
A3: Costs can differ based upon the extent of the work needed, but standard remodellings can vary from a few hundred to several thousand dollars.
Q4: Will renovating my sash windows improve home insulation?
A4: Yes, correct renovation can considerably improve insulation, particularly when attending to gaps and applying modern-day weatherproofing techniques.
Q5: Are there any grants readily available for renovating historical windows?
A5: In some areas, there may be local or nationwide grants offered for preserving historical features. It's beneficial to talk to local government or heritage companies.
